Description
Measured in a cell proliferation assay using TF-1 human erythroleukemic cells. Kitamura, T. et al. (1989) J. Cell Physiol. 140:323. The ED50 for this effect is 1-5 ng/mL. The specific activity of Recombinant Human SCF is approximately 1.3 x 106 IU/mg, which is calibrated against recombinant human SCF WHO International Standard (NIBSC code: 91/682). Specific activity is for reference purposes only and is not routinely tested.Order Info
